testRigor is a generative AI-based no-code test automation tool that lets you describe test scenarios in plain English and automatically convert them into executable end-to-end test scripts. It aims to lower the technical barriers to creating and maintaining tests, helping teams boost testing efficiency, coverage, and software quality.

Features of testRigor

Describe test scenarios in plain English; AI automatically generates executable test scripts.
AI-powered behavior capture to automatically generate and maintain tests for common workflows.
Tests no longer rely on brittle UI locators like XPath, enhancing test stability.
Supports Web, mobile apps, desktop apps, APIs, and testing of messaging and telephony scenarios.
Cloud or on-premises deployment options, with configurable OS and parallel execution capacity.
Integrates with Jira, TestRail, and other leading development and test management tools.
Supports data-driven testing, environment variable management, and detailed execution reports and logs.

Use Cases of testRigor

Used by manual testers when converting manual test cases into automated scripts.
Used by teams performing Web, mobile, or desktop end-to-end regression testing.
Used when validating business processes involving complex interactions such as email, SMS, or multi-factor authentication.
Used when product managers or business analysts directly participate in creating automated acceptance tests.
Used by development teams integrating automated tests into CI/CD pipelines for rapid validation.
Used by enterprises needing cross-platform consistency and accessibility testing.
Used when teams want to reduce maintenance caused by frontend UI changes.

FAQ about testRigor

QWhat is testRigor?

testRigor is an AI-powered no-code test automation tool that lets you describe test steps in plain English, with AI generating and executing end-to-end tests.

QWho are the main users of testRigor?

Primarily aimed at manual testers, product managers, business analysts, and development and QA teams seeking to lower automation barriers.

QDo you need programming skills to use testRigor?

No. The core design is to enable users to create tests with natural language, allowing non-technical team members to participate in automation.

QWhat types of applications does testRigor support testing?

Supports Web applications, mobile apps (native iOS/Android and hybrid), desktop apps, API testing, and tests involving SMS, calls, and emails.

QAre test scripts easy to maintain with testRigor?

Its design avoids brittle UI locators (like XPath) to improve stability and reduce maintenance caused by frontend changes.

QCan testRigor integrate with existing development tools?

Yes. testRigor supports integration with Jira, TestRail, CI/CD pipelines, and other development and test management tools.

QHow does testRigor handle data security and compliance?

According to its public information, testRigor has SOC 2 Type II certification. For security measures and applicable scope, please refer to the official security documentation.
